Tulips Tulips Tulips - I love them.

My crafty friend brought over the Mama Elephant Timeless Tulips and we decided to stray from our diecutting (so safe and forgiving) to watercoloring (going adventurous).  We stamped and clear embossed on watercolor paper many times in a couple of different positions.  We also stamped with light brown water based ink for no line coloring later.  All the watercoloring was done with Zig Clean brush markers.

I do love my tulips and all the colors they come in!  Hope you enjoy this set of cards.
